In Hanover:
Yama, good Korean and Sushi. Very moderately priced with good lunch specials.Canoe Club, a bit more upscale American fare. They have a nice children's menu as well.
Jewel of India, passable Indian food if you really crave Indian. Service is a bit indifferent.
Lou's, a casual diner institution. I don't love this place-- but it is good with kids-- and they have nice breakfasts.
A bit north of Hanover in Lyme is a place that my kids love, Stella's Kitchen. Nice Italian/pizza in a very warm atmosphere.
A bit south in White River is the Tip Top Cafe-- inventive with lots of veg options.
